Output 04347435641a68d3a0aa974f63f903efe1e2a50f9186b011bfa9e15c7fc70a4c:1

value
53086922
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29fd52c0ef77aedd3cf6af88c4961a2ba48c544f OP_EQUALVERIFY OP_CHECKSIG
address
14q2B5GB44uWGxBZvGtn4CprCP46A6bRT6
transaction
04347435641a68d3a0aa974f63f903efe1e2a50f9186b011bfa9e15c7fc70a4c
spent
true